Nick McGuirk

Said the following about Megan Moore:

“Megan noted a message via the company's social media platform from an unknown male member of the public. The message stated that he wanted to apologise to a Train on one of the Services and hoped that they would recover fast and it was not personal.

Megan engaged with the male via the social media platform, they did not respond but Megan reached out again and asked if they wanted to talk. At this point, the male specifically stated that he intended suicide. Megan immediately raised the alarm to the control, she identified that the male was at a certain station.

As well as raising the alarm to the main control centre to put a caution on the line, Megan spoke directly to the Station colleagues. Megan requested that they conduct a welfare check of the station. The station colleagues found the male on the tracks, the train was brought to a stop and the male was thankfully taken to a place of safety.

Megan remained calm throughout, even though she was confronted with the additional challenge of not being able to see what was unfolding. Megan applied her training from the Samaritans Managing Suicidal Contacts and her actions without doubt saved the males life.“
